Due to the fact that Gazprom does not give permission to include the Beregovoye gas field in the gas transportation system of Russia, the gas balance of Russia did not receive more than 2bn cubic meters of gas in 2003. If the problem of the Beregovoye field is not settled in the near future, Russian gas pipelines will not receive 6bn cubic meters this year. Valery Otchertsov, the Chairman of the Management Board of ITERA Oil and Gas Company, declared.
According to him, it is necessary to work out a clear and compulsory technique to ensure independent gas producers have access to the system of backbone gas pipelines.
ITERA invested $280m in the Beregovoye gas field and it was put on operation in 2003, but it has not been used till now because Gazprom will not give permission to include it in the gas transportation system of Russia, Otchertsov said.
"This is not the problem of a single private company but of the gas industry in general. This situation does not contribute to investment attractiveness of Russian gas projects," Otchertsov pointed out.
